4 bedroom Mid Terrace Property for sale, Mytholmes Lane, Haworth, West Yorkshire, BD22
Features and Description
- Stunning setting tucked away in the countryside.
- Many period features in this terraced cottage.
- Four bedrooms and master with an en-suite.
- Off street parking and garage.
- Underfloor heating in the kitchen.
- The property has a handy storage cellar.
For sale is a beautiful, terraced cottage, rich in character with four double bedrooms, which makes it ideal for families or downsizers. This property boasts of period features that lend a timeless charm to the residence, yet is equipped with all modern conveniences, offering a perfect blend of the old and the new.
The house accommodates one spacious reception room that captivates with its oak beams and an inviting gas fire, further enhanced by a charming window seat, providing the perfect spot for relaxation. The kitchen is a focal point of the property, fitted with quartz countertops and the added luxury of underfloor heating, assuring warmth and comfort during the colder months.
Four double bedrooms offer ample living space. The master bedroom stands out with its en-suite bathroom and built-in wardrobes, offering both comfort and practicality. The third bedroom, a loft room, provides a unique and versatile space while each bedroom is spacious enough for a double bed.
The house also includes a bathroom equipped with a free-standing bath and built-in storage for added convenience. The single garage is an added bonus, providing secure parking or additional storage space.
Situated in a secluded location, the property offers tranquillity and privacy, yet is near the historic village of Haworth and its many amenities. This terraced house is not just a property, but a home filled with character, catering to contemporary living whilst retaining its unique period charm. It is indeed a rare find in today's property market.
